alltheseas

Results 1411 comments of alltheseas

First steps by @auggie-lahey below. Auggie to describe more https://github.com/user-attachments/assets/e494c818-8985-4a05-9eb8-0b7b0acdfcb6 https://njump.me/nevent1qvzqqqqqqypzp4cd2qy32p9ejtgc8zpz4uj96hmt8gttstv30t9hjfxw7c0dft8wqy2hwumn8ghj7un9d3shjtnyv9kh2uewd9hj7qgwwaehxw309ahx7uewd3hkctcqypknxeje2ehmmfl3gjn9s8j05x4nns6c06wparuu5z3xwgsppf8auejlgaf https://github.com/auggie-lahey/nostr-desktop-test-automation

@hugs you available for a call this week? @auggie-lahey has a question about how you approach various CSS + buttons setups on various web apps that serve the same functionality...

> Call this morning to discuss more nostr testing stuff and I'm thinking of changing the entire project structure. > 1) "unit testing" would move to individual client repos. >...

few next steps: - [x] create schemata dev documentation https://github.com/nostrability/nostrability/issues/198 @dskvr - [ ] review documentation @auggie-lahey @amunrarara @alltheseas - [ ] add schemata nip-10 test case @auggie-lahey

Schemata documentation is up thanks to @dskvr - https://github.com/nostrability/schemata. I've been tinkering with codex/vibe agents to create schemas. Results are mostly good, with the occasional red flag. NIP-10 draft PR:...

[nip-10 schema](https://github.com/nostrability/schemata/pull/29) valdation results pulling 500 events from a single relay ### NIP-10 Results ``` - Pulled 500 events → 469 passed, 31 failed the NIP‑10 checks (results/nip10-summary-kind- 1-1758579789.json). -...

Hey @vitorpamplona, the NIP-10 JSON validation scheme test detected [an Amethyst enjoyer ](https://njump.me/nevent1qqszrg3g5pekyhhx8jqgt6jxwxhknk6u0s5pd2pxhztdfzlt3gnxkdgma5v37)(deab79dafa1c2be4b4a6d3aca1357b6caa0b744bf46ad529a5ae464288579e68 → npub1m64hnkh6rs47fd9x6wk2zdtmdj4qkazt734d22d94ery9zzhne5qw9uaks) is generating NIP-10 replies that do not pass the NIP-10 schema. You can search for...

Just [confirmed](https://njump.me/nevent1qqs2kssngwuuwsuwpflwgq8h774f4pe2wuzwxy7dh46g3s723c4pp2qjl0t36) that errors by 8450399ee088ae9e65a3dd70512bf2e5831d19ff876d772000eb3ea9c2cf03fe -> npub1s3grn8hq3zhfuedrm4c9z2ljukp36x0lsakhwgqqavl2nsk0q0lqpv2tvy are also caused by Amethyst @vitorpamplona

In the above set of NIP-10 schema validations, > every failure came from marked e tags that left the marker blank ("" instead of reply/root/mention)

> Blank ones are the middle replies between the root and the direct parent reply. We add as many e tags as possible to the reply to facilitate thread loading....